Multiskan Ascent microplate photometer offers superior photometric measurement performance for 96- and 384-well plates. This instrument reads the plate rapidly and can be connected to robotic systems for increased throughput in photometric reading.
Excellent optical performance for 96- and 384-well plates The high-quality optical system of the Multiskan Ascent ensures excellent reproducibility, accuracy and reliable results. The unit is linear up to an outstanding 4 Abs units with 96-well plates and up to 3 Abs units with 384-well plates, eliminating the need to dilute samples and saving time in obtaining sample results. In HTS assays with 384-well plates, the Multiskan Ascent has shown excellent consistency of the signal across all wells in the plate (low intraplate variation). Additonally, no bias was observed in the IC50 as a result of curves being set up in different parts of the plate or between two separate plates (interplate variation). A good correlation was also observed in two different experiments using the same group of compounds (low interassay variation).
Fast measurements Multiskan Ascent provides not only extreme accuracy and precision, but also very rapid measurements: It takes only 9 seconds to measure a 96-well plate and only 20 seconds to measure a 384-well plate.
Easy and flexible robot integration Another feature that makes Multiskan Ascent ideal for high-throughput environments is its simple and easy robot integration.
Optional incubator An optional internal incubator can be included for assays requiring temperature control. Temperature can reach up to 50°C.
